Hair Care Secrets: Why Horsetail Oil is a Game-Changer

Nature often holds the key to achieving healthier hair. Among the numerous botanical wonders, horsetail, an ancient plant utilized for centuries in herbal remedies, stands out as a powerful ally in hair care.

Horsetail, scientifically known as Equisetum arvense, is a perennial plant found in the cold areas of the northern hemisphere. The plant branches out, resembling a horse's mane or tail, hence the horsetail.

Horsetail oil is a plant-based extract highly potent in antioxidants, vitamins, and minerals, thereby facilitating the growth of thick and lustrous hair.

Ward off free radical damage

UV rays can create free radicals within the hair structure, damaging hair melanin and essential components required for hair growth, like amino acids, peptides, and proteins.

Antioxidants found in Horsetail oil prevent free radicals from invading and shrinking the cells surrounding your hair follicles, thus protecting your hair from damage.

Relieve scalp inflammations

A healthy scalp is the foundation for robust hair growth. Horsetail possesses an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ties that soothe the scalp and alleviate common ailments such as dandruff and itching.

It can potentially hinder the growth of bacteria and fungi, thereby preventing itchy and flaky scalp conditions.
